Chapter 1
A Long-Expected Party
- Shire
- Bilbo's 111th birthday party
- Gandalf arrives
- Party preparations
- Bilbo says farewell
- Gandalf meets Bilbo back at Bag End
- Discussion about Bilbo's plans
- Bilbo tries to leave with the ring
- Bilbo departs
- Frodo arrives
- Gandalf doesn't say much about the ring
- People coming to get things from Bag End
- Gandalf and Frodo have a discussion in the evening
- True story of how Bilbo obtained the ring
- Gandalf begins to wonder about the ring
- Tells Frodo not to use it
- Gandalf departs, Frodo does not see him again for a long time

Chapter 2
The Shadow of the Past
- Shire
- This chapter covers a lot of time between the birthday party and the beginning of Frodo's quest
- Rumors of strange things, strangers passing through the Shire, elves going west
- Gandalf does not appear for several years
- Sam introduced as Frodo's gardner
- Gandalf first appears 3 years after the birthday party
- Shows up frequently for 1-2 years
- Disappears for nine years
- Gandalf appears one day
- Gandalf tells Frodo about the rings of power
- Mortals do not die/do not grow/merely continues
- The ring will change shape/size
- Gandalf recounts the White Council discussing how to drive Sauron from Mirkwood (just before the Battle of Five Armies)
- Bilbo lying about the ring to claim it (parallels Smeagol behavior)
- Gandalf raises prospect of Sauron invading the Shire
- Ring is thrown into the fire, ancient Elvish characters but language of Mordor
- Gandalf reveals that it is the One Ring
- Sauron discovered the ring was not lost, gathering strength in Mordor, looking for the ring
- Some history on the ring
- Isildur (Elendil's son) cut the One Ring from Sauron's hand
- Sauron retreated, eventually fled to Mirkwood
- Isildur attacked by Orcs, ring fell into the Great River
- Deagol/Smeagol story
- Smeagol wanders, begins obsessing, stealing, takes name Gollum
- Retreated into the Misty Mountains, Sauron knew nothing of the ring
- Similarities between river folk (Smeagol) and hobbits (love of riddles)
- Gollumn growing to hate the dark, hate the light, hate the ring
- Ring of power looks after itself
- Gandalf reveals he has talked with Gollumn, finding him
- Precious
- Mirkwood elves helped track Gollum
